CaixaBank and CEV renew and intensify their alliance to support companies in the Valencian Community

The territorial director of CaixaBank in the Valencian Community and the Region of Murcia, Olga Garciaand the president of the CEV, Salvador Navarrohave renewed the collaboration agreement that both entities maintain to support companies and self-employed people in the autonomous community. The agreement will allow the implementation of a plan to promote the promotion and implementation of joint actions in strategic and priority areas of socio-economic development in the Valencian Community, with special emphasis on sustainable business projects within the framework of European regulations.

When signing the agreement, the territorial director of CaixaBank indicated that “we want to continue to be very close to the companies of the Valencian Community, accompanying and supporting them in their growth and development, financing their projects and promoting innovation and the transition to a more sustainable economy”. “Companies contribute to the creation of wealth, jobs and, therefore, to the well-being of all, which is why our commitment to them is firm because they are essential to the development and evolution of our societies”, stressed García.

CaixaBank financed companies in the Valencian Community for a total of 2,052 million euros during the first half of 2024, representing a growth of 24% compared to the same period of the previous year. This figure corresponds to a total of 8,292 operations, 11% more than in the first six months of last year.

The financial institution has 27 offices and specialized centers in the Valencian Community to exclusively meet the needs of companies. A large team of professionals expert in global business management works in these spaces, offering a unique and differentiated value proposition.

The agreement between the CEV and CaixaBank demonstrates, once again, the commitment of both entities to the Valencian economic fabric and the development of the Valencian Community, in addition to offering environmental, social and governance advice to channel sustainable financing.

To meet this objective, the agreement prioritizes the support of the CEV in the intense work it carries out to inform, promote and compile business projects in the three provinces likely to receive sustainable financing.

With this agreement, CaixaBank renews and intensifies its support and commitment to the economic fabric of the Community. In addition, the financial institution collaborates with initiatives that promote innovation, entrepreneurship and business competitiveness.

Financing lines for businesses

The two entities will also promote the existing collaboration agreement between CaixaBank and the Spanish Confederation of Professional Organizations. (CEO)which makes it possible to make available a very important line of financing to companies affiliated to the employers’ union and their professional organizations. The aim of the agreement is to support the Spanish business world to improve its productivity and contribute to the development of innovation projects, stimulate internationalization and promote entrepreneurship.

On the other hand, they will continue to activate the collaboration between CaixaBank Dualiza and the CEV to promote vocational training and its dual modality with the aim of improving the employability of workers.
